Subject: [PATCH 08/23] libata-sff: reorder SFF/BMDMA functions
Date: Mon, 10 May 2010 21:41:32 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1273520507-32459-9-git-send-email-tj@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1273520507-32459-1-git-send-email-tj@kernel.org>

Reorder functions such that SFF and BMDMA functions are grouped.
While at it, s/BMDMA/SFF in a few comments where it actually meant
SFF.

Signed-off-by: Tejun Heo <tj@kernel.org>
---
 drivers/ata/libata-sff.c |  448 +++++++++++++++++++++++-----------------------
 include/linux/libata.h   |   21 ++-
 2 files changed, 238 insertions(+), 231 deletions(-)

+
+const struct ata_port_operations ata_bmdma_port_ops = {
+	.inherits		= &ata_sff_port_ops,
+
+	.mode_filter		= ata_bmdma_mode_filter,
+
+	.bmdma_setup		= ata_bmdma_setup,
+	.bmdma_start		= ata_bmdma_start,
+	.bmdma_stop		= ata_bmdma_stop,
+	.bmdma_status		= ata_bmdma_status,
+};
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_bmdma_port_ops);
+
+const struct ata_port_operations ata_bmdma32_port_ops = {
+	.inherits		= &ata_bmdma_port_ops,
+
+	.sff_data_xfer		= ata_sff_data_xfer32,
+	.port_start		= ata_sff_port_start32,
+};
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_bmdma32_port_ops);
+
+unsigned long ata_bmdma_mode_filter(struct ata_device *adev,
+				    unsigned long xfer_mask)
+{
+	/* Filter out DMA modes if the device has been configured by
+	   the BIOS as PIO only */
+
+	if (adev->link->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r == NULL)
+		xfer_mask &= ~(ATA_MASK_MWDMA | ATA_MASK_UDMA);
+	return xfer_mask;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_bmdma_mode_filter);
+
+/**
+ *	ata_bmdma_setup - Set up PCI IDE BMDMA transaction
+ *	@qc: Info associated with this ATA transaction.
+ *
+ *	LOCKING:
+ *	spin_lock_irqsave(host lock)
+ */
+void ata_bmdma_setup(struct ata_queued_cmd *qc)
+{
+	struct ata_port *ap = qc->ap;
+	unsigned int rw = (qc->tf.flags & ATA_TFLAG_WRITE);
+	u8 dmactl;
+
+	/* load PRD table addr. */
+	mb();	/* make sure PRD table writes are visible to controller */
+	iowrite32(ap->prd_dma, 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r + ATA_DMA_TABLE_OFS);
+
+	/* specify data direction, triple-check start bit is clear */
+	dmactl = ioread8(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r + ATA_DMA_CMD);
+	dmactl &= ~(ATA_DMA_WR | ATA_DMA_START);
+	if (!rw)
+		dmactl |= ATA_DMA_WR;
+	iowrite8(dmactl, 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r + ATA_DMA_CMD);
+
+	/* issue r/w command */
+	ap->ops->sff_exec_command(ap, &qc->tf);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_bmdma_setup);
+
+/**
+ *	ata_bmdma_start - Start a PCI IDE BMDMA transaction
+ *	@qc: Info associated with this ATA transaction.
+ *
+ *	LOCKING:
+ *	spin_lock_irqsave(host lock)
+ */
+void ata_bmdma_start(struct ata_queued_cmd *qc)
+{
+	struct ata_port *ap = qc->ap;
+	u8 dmactl;
+
+	/* start host DMA transaction */
+	dmactl = ioread8(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r + ATA_DMA_CMD);
+	iowrite8(dmactl | ATA_DMA_START, 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r + ATA_DMA_CMD);
+
+	/* Strictly, one may wish to issue an ioread8() here, to
+	 * flush the mmio write.  However, control also passes
+	 * to the hardware at this point, and it will interrupt
+	 * us when we are to resume control.  So, in effect,
+	 * we don't care when the mmio write flushes.
+	 * Further, a read of the DMA status register _immediately_
+	 * following the write may not be what certain flaky hardware
+	 * is expected, so I think it is best to not add a readb()
+	 * without first all the MMIO ATA cards/mobos.
+	 * Or maybe I'm just being paranoid.
+	 *
+	 * FIXME: The posting of this write means I/O starts are
+	 * unneccessarily delayed for MMIO
+	 */
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_bmdma_start);
+
+/**
+ *	ata_bmdma_stop - Stop PCI IDE BMDMA transfer
+ *	@qc: Command we are ending DMA for
+ *
+ *	Clears the ATA_DMA_START flag in the dma control register
+ *
+ *	May be used as the bmdma_stop() entry in ata_port_operations.
+ *
+ *	LOCKING:
+ *	spin_lock_irqsave(host lock)
+ */
+void ata_bmdma_stop(struct ata_queued_cmd *qc)
+{
+	struct ata_port *ap = qc->ap;
+	void __iomem *mmio = 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r;
+
+	/* clear start/stop bit */
+	iowrite8(ioread8(mmio + ATA_DMA_CMD) & ~ATA_DMA_START,
+		 mmio + ATA_DMA_CMD);
+
+	/* one-PIO-cycle guaranteed wait, per spec, for HDMA1:0 transition */
+	ata_sff_dma_pause(ap);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_bmdma_stop);
+
+/**
+ *	ata_bmdma_status - Read PCI IDE BMDMA status
+ *	@ap: Port associated with this ATA transaction.
+ *
+ *	Read and return BMDMA status register.
+ *
+ *	May be used as the bmdma_status() entry in ata_port_operations.
+ *
+ *	LOCKING:
+ *	spin_lock_irqsave(host lock)
+ */
+u8 ata_bmdma_status(struct ata_port *ap)
+{
+	return ioread8(ap->ioaddr.bmdma_addr + ATA_DMA_STATUS);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_bmdma_status);
